Off-site run — item 2: Backup tapes, week 14 set. Grab the grey Pelacase from the server room shelf — should be six tapes, check the tally sheet taped inside the lid. These head to the Vault Row storage facility on the Merrowgate run. Don't leave them in a hot van, please. Hand the case over only when the courier gives this phrase:

handover note for tadug-yaguf: the aldath pelwyn courier leaves the casox norwyn briix silok zorok kasdor aldion quenox ledger at gate 2653 under passcode 959015

Handover Note — Inventory Write-Down

To the incoming Director of Operations:

The Q2 write-down on the Ashfield warehouse stock stands at 410k, mainly obsolete Fenwick components. Auditors have accepted the methodology; final sign-off pending. Remaining risk: 120k in slow-moving units flagged for review next quarter. Disposal contracts are in place. Keep Finance copied on any revisions. One confidential matter is set out below.

management briefing: Project Ulavan slips by two quarters because of the staffing delay.

## Step 4: Deploy the Extracted User Module

Reviewers: confirm that the Lorebank user module builds independently of the monolith and that the session shim still forwards legacy calls. The deploy pipeline publishes the module to the internal registry in Cravenmoor, then flips the routing flag. No monolith code should import the new package directly — only the API client. Before approving, verify the artifact signature matches the deploy key below.

rollout seal: bky4_x7Gc